diff --git a/package.json b/package.json index ea6f798..ac479df 100644 --- a/package.json +++ b/package.json @@ -13,7 +13,10 @@ "@fortawesome/free-regular-svg-icons": "^6.2.1", "@fortawesome/free-solid-svg-icons": "^6.2.1", "@fortawesome/vue-fontawesome": "^3.0.2", + "@popperjs/core": "^2.11.6", + "bootstrap": "^5.2.2", "core-js": "^3.8.3", + "jquery": "^3.6.1", "vue": "^3.2.13", "vue-router": "^4.1.6" }, diff --git a/src/App.vue b/src/App.vue index 6e552a0..815fc0f 100644 --- a/src/App.vue +++ b/src/App.vue @@ -21,6 +21,8 @@ export default { diff --git a/src/components/SchedulePlace.vue b/src/components/SchedulePlace.vue new file mode 100644 index 0000000..115a58b --- /dev/null +++ b/src/components/SchedulePlace.vue @@ -0,0 +1,31 @@ + + + + + diff --git a/src/components/ScheduleRoute.vue b/src/components/ScheduleRoute.vue new file mode 100644 index 0000000..709b4ac --- /dev/null +++ b/src/components/ScheduleRoute.vue @@ -0,0 +1,39 @@ + + + + + diff --git a/src/components/ScheduleRouteList.vue b/src/components/ScheduleRouteList.vue new file mode 100644 index 0000000..5553a68 --- /dev/null +++ b/src/components/ScheduleRouteList.vue @@ -0,0 +1,19 @@ + + + + + diff --git a/src/main.js b/src/main.js index 126d960..cc49b5e 100644 --- a/src/main.js +++ b/src/main.js @@ -1,5 +1,6 @@ import { createApp } from 'vue' import { createRouter, createWebHistory } from 'vue-router' +import 'bootstrap' import routes from '@/routes' import App from '@/App' import { library } from '@fortawesome/fontawesome-svg-core' diff --git a/src/pages/SchedulePage.vue b/src/pages/SchedulePage.vue index 4a3e691..3a0eb99 100644 --- a/src/pages/SchedulePage.vue +++ b/src/pages/SchedulePage.vue @@ -1,54 +1,15 @@ diff --git a/yarn.lock b/yarn.lock index fdbabbb..cf0d31b 100644 --- a/yarn.lock +++ b/yarn.lock @@ -1134,6 +1134,11 @@ resolved "https://registry.yarnpkg.com/@polka/url/-/url-1.0.0-next.21.tgz#5de5a2385a35309427f6011992b544514d559aa1" integrity sha512-a5Sab1C4/icpTZVzZc5Ghpz88yQtGOyNqYXcZgOssB2uuAr+wF/MvN6bgtW32q7HHrvBki+BsZ0OuNv6EV3K9g== +"@popperjs/core@^2.11.6": + version "2.11.6" + resolved "https://registry.yarnpkg.com/@popperjs/core/-/core-2.11.6.tgz#cee20bd55e68a1720bdab363ecf0c821ded4cd45" + integrity sha512-50/17A98tWUfQ176raKiOGXuYpLyyVMkxxG6oylzL3BPOlA6ADGdK7EYunSa4I064xerltq9TGXs8HmOk5E+vw== + "@sideway/address@^4.1.3": version "4.1.4" resolved "https://registry.yarnpkg.com/@sideway/address/-/address-4.1.4.tgz#03dccebc6ea47fdc226f7d3d1ad512955d4783f0" @@ -2129,6 +2134,11 @@ boolbase@^1.0.0: resolved "https://registry.yarnpkg.com/boolbase/-/boolbase-1.0.0.tgz#68dff5fbe60c51eb37725ea9e3ed310dcc1e776e" integrity sha512-JZOSA7Mo9sNGB8+UjSgzdLtokWAky1zbztM3WRLCbZ70/3cTANmQmOdR7y2g+J0e2WXywy1yS468tY+IruqEww== +bootstrap@^5.2.2: + version "5.2.2" + resolved "https://registry.yarnpkg.com/bootstrap/-/bootstrap-5.2.2.tgz#834e053eed584a65e244d8aa112a6959f56e27a0" + integrity sha512-dEtzMTV71n6Fhmbg4fYJzQsw1N29hJKO1js5ackCgIpDcGid2ETMGC6zwSYw09v05Y+oRdQ9loC54zB1La3hHQ== + brace-expansion@^1.1.7: version "1.1.11" resolved "https://registry.yarnpkg.com/brace-expansion/-/brace-expansion-1.1.11.tgz#3c7fcbf529d87226f3d2f52b966ff5271eb441dd" @@ -3842,6 +3852,11 @@ joi@^17.4.0: "@sideway/formula" "^3.0.0" "@sideway/pinpoint" "^2.0.0" +jquery@^3.6.1: + version "3.6.1" + resolved "https://registry.yarnpkg.com/jquery/-/jquery-3.6.1.tgz#fab0408f8b45fc19f956205773b62b292c147a16" + integrity sha512-opJeO4nCucVnsjiXOE+/PcCgYw9Gwpvs/a6B1LL/lQhwWwpbVEVYDZ1FokFr8PRc7ghYlrFPuyHuiiDNTQxmcw== + js-message@1.0.7: version "1.0.7" resolved "https://registry.yarnpkg.com/js-message/-/js-message-1.0.7.tgz#fbddd053c7a47021871bb8b2c95397cc17c20e47"